How much is a round-trip flight from Indianapolis to New York John F Kennedy Intl Airport?

What’s the cheapest day of the week to fly from Indianapolis to New York John F Kennedy Airport?

The average price of all round-trip flights from Indianapolis to New York John F Kennedy Intl Airport clicked on KAYAK for each day over the last 12 months.

Your flight ticket price will generally be cheaper if you fly to New York John F Kennedy Airport on a Saturday and more expensive on a Monday. On your return trip to Indianapolis, you should consider flying back on a Tuesday, and avoid Sundays for better deals.

What is the cheapest month to fly from Indianapolis to New York John F Kennedy Intl Airport?

To calculate monthly average prices, KAYAK takes all prices for each month over the last year for round-trip flights from Indianapolis to New York John F Kennedy Intl Airport, removes the top 0.1% to account for outliers, and then takes the median of all values for each month.

The cheapest month for flights from Indianapolis to New York John F Kennedy Intl Airport is January, where tickets cost $213 (return) on average. On the other hand, the most expensive months are December and November, where the average cost of round-trip tickets is $295 and $288 respectively.

Can I save money by flying with a layover from Indianapolis to New York John F Kennedy Intl Airport?

The average round-trip price for all non-stop flights, flights with one layover, and flights with two layovers for the route found by users searching on KAYAK in the last 2 weeks.

Yes, flying with a layover may cost you more time, but you can also save money on the route, with a 1 stop layover the cheapest option at $482 on average.

How far in advance should I book a flight from Indianapolis to New York John F Kennedy Intl Airport?

To calculate weekly average prices, KAYAK takes all prices for each week before departure over the last year for round-trip flights from Indianapolis to New York John F Kennedy Intl Airport, removes the top 0.1% to account for outliers, and then takes the average of all the values for each week.

To get a below average price on the flight from Indianapolis to New York John F Kennedy Intl Airport, you should book around 3 weeks before departure, which saves you about 21% compared to booking last minute. For the absolute cheapest price, our data suggests you should book 24 weeks before departure.

FAQs for booking Indianapolis to New York John F Kennedy Airport flights

  • What is the cheapest flight from Indianapolis to New York John F Kennedy Intl Airport?

    In the last 3 days, the lowest price for a flight from Indianapolis to New York John F Kennedy Intl Airport was $78 for a one-way ticket and $139 for a round-trip.

  • Do I need a passport to fly between Indianapolis and New York John F Kennedy Airport?

    Even though you are not required to have a passport, keep in mind that an official ID is needed to board the airplane.

  • Which airlines offer Wi-Fi service onboard planes from Indianapolis to New York John F Kennedy Airport?

    All the following airlines offer inflight Wi-Fi service on the Indianapolis to New York John F Kennedy Airport flight route: American Airlines, Delta, JetBlue, Air Canada, Iberia, British Airways, Finnair, and Virgin Atlantic.

  • Which aircraft models fly most regularly from Indianapolis to New York John F Kennedy Airport?

    The Embraer 175 is the aircraft model that flies most regularly on the Indianapolis to New York John F Kennedy Airport flight route.

  • Which airline alliances offer flights from Indianapolis to New York John F Kennedy Airport?

    oneworld, and SkyTeam are the airline alliances operating flights between Indianapolis and New York John F Kennedy Airport, with SkyTeam being the most commonly used for this route.

  • On which days can I fly direct from Indianapolis to New York John F Kennedy Airport?

    There are nonstop flights from Indianapolis to New York John F Kennedy Airport on a daily basis.

  • Which is the best airline for flights from Indianapolis to New York, Delta or American Airlines?

    The two airlines most popular with KAYAK users for flights from Indianapolis to New York are Delta and American Airlines. With an average price for the route of $236 and an overall rating of 7.9, Delta is the most popular choice. American Airlines is also a great choice for the route, with an average price of $259 and an overall rating of 7.2.

  • What is the Hacker Fare option on flights from Indianapolis to New York John F Kennedy Airport?

    Hacker Fares allow you to combine one-way tickets in order to save you money over a traditional round-trip ticket. You could then fly to New York John F Kennedy Airport with an airline and back to Indianapolis with another airline. Booking your flights between Indianapolis and JFK can sometimes prove cheaper using this method.
